Mavrelous wrote:Man, what a game by Lively, that long offensive rebound and kickout to THJ for 3+1 was something else...


That was a nice Lively play. He’s definitely infused some energy into the team. I also enjoyed these two plays too (sorry I don’t know how to embed the fancy clips):

2Q: Lively had a screen slip and roll for a dunk. His role was easy, but I loved the dynamics of the play. It was quintessential NBA type play, where we took advantage of our guys strengths and put the defense in a bad position. It was basically a 3v3 play.

4Q: Lively caught the ball in the paint off a semi-fast break, immediately looked opposite side and hit a wide open THJ for a three. It appears he took note of THJ on the wing while coming down the court and quickly noticed Demar was stuck helping at the rim. I think most young big guys go straight up for a contested baby hook, travel, or even commit an offensive foul there.
